Why Is Walmart Clearing Out Home Improvement Tools?

Clearance events at major retailers like Walmart often occur for several strategic reasons. Primarily, they help clear out inventory to make room for new and updated products. In 2026, this is particularly relevant as advancements in tool technology continue at a rapid pace.

Additionally, these sales can assist in realigning inventory with current consumer demands. As sustainable and smart home technologies become increasingly popular, the tools required for such projects are likewise evolving. Walmart's clearance might be driven by a need to clear space for tools that cater to these emerging trends.

How to Make the Most of the Clearance

Shopping a clearance smartly involves a few strategic steps:

  • Research Before You Shop: Understanding which tools are being cleared out and comparing their prices online can provide insight into the value of the deals being offered.
  • Set Priorities: Determine which tools you truly need versus those that are simply 'nice to have.' This helps prevent impulse buying and ensures you invest in tools that will be used frequently.
  • Check Reviews: Online reviews can provide valuable insights into the performance and longevity of a tool, guiding you to the best deals that don't compromise on quality.

Expert Tips for Budgeting and Long-Term Planning

Balancing your budget with the desire for the latest tools can be challenging. Here are some expert tips to guide you:

  • Create a Tool Budget: Start by setting a realistic budget for your tool shopping. Allocate specific amounts to high-priority items.
  • Consider Long-Term Benefits: Spending a little extra on robust and durable tools can lead to savings in maintenance and replacements over time.
  • Plan for Future Projects: Buy tools that align with projects you anticipate starting in the next few years to maximize the utility of your purchases.
